So, this was weird: Rory McIlroy, playing his second shot from the rough on the 11th at Royal Portrush in Round 3 of the British Open, somehow managed to unearth another ball in mid-swing. The second ball was apparently embedded in the ground a few inches ahead of McIlroy's ball, and popped into the air as McIlroy's shot flew greenward.

McIlroy has used two caddies during his professional golf career. His first was named J.P. Fitzgerald, who he had on his bag until 2017. McIlroy then switched to Harry Diamond, who has been his caddie over the last eight years.
